    Abstract: A fail-safe air flap control apparatus for a vehicle includes a coolant temperature sensor, a control unit, an actuator, a movable unit, a flap unit, an elastic member and a solenoid unit. The coolant temperature sensor measures the temperature of a coolant. The control unit compares a value measured by the sensor to a reference value and generates a corresponding control signal. The actuator has a rotator which rotates in a clockwise or counterclockwise direction depending on the control signal. The movable unit linearly moves under rotational force of the rotator. The flap unit includes a flap housing having an air flow slot, a flap door mounted to the flap housing to openably close the air flow slot, and a connecting rod connected to the movable unit. The elastic member applies elastic force to the movable unit in a direction in which the flap door opens.

    Abstract: An air-conditioner for a vehicle, may include a casing having an upper outlet and a lower outlet, with an air flow space defined in the casing and including an upper space and a lower space to guide air to the upper outlet and/or the lower outlet, an evaporator installed in the casing and selectively communicating with the upper outlet through the upper space, and a distributing partition wall to partition the lower space into a receiving space to receive a heating member therein and selectively communicate with the upper space and at least a partitioned space to communicate the heating member with the lower outlet, thus guiding the air to a side portion of the casing.

    Abstract: A liquid crystal display includes a liquid crystal panel having a color filter including a red filter, a transparent filter, and a blue filter, and a backlight panel at a rear of the liquid crystal panel. The backlight panel includes electron emission regions and a phosphor layer that emits light when excited by electrons emitted from the electron emission regions. The phosphor layer includes a first phosphor layer having a red phosphor and a blue phosphor, and a second phosphor layer having a green phosphor. The backlight panel is configured to emit light from the first phosphor layer and the second phosphor layer sequentially.

    Abstract: A light emission device for simplifying a structure of an electron emission unit and a manufacturing process thereof is provided. A display device using the light emission device as a light source is also provided. The light emission device includes a vacuum panel having a first substrate and a second substrate facing each other. A sealing member is between the first and second substrates. Recesss portions each have a depth into a side of the first substrate facing the second substrate. Cathode electrodes are in corresponding recesses. Electron emission regions are on corresponding cathode electrodes. A gate electrode is fixed at one side of the first substrate at a distance from the electron emission regions. A light emission unit is at one side of the second substrate. The gate electrode includes a mesh unit having openings for passing through an electron beam and a supporting member surrounding the mesh unit.

    Abstract: Disclosed is a substrate construction for immobilizing a physiological material that has a substrate; an organic polymer linker material layer formed on the substrate; and a gold thin layer formed on the organic polymer linker material layer. The organic polymer linker material layer has a thickness ranging form 30 to 200 nm and shows peaks of 111 and 200 planes using X-ray diffractometry when the X-rays radiate at an incident angle of 1.5. The substrate is prepared through the processes of forming an organic polymer linker material layer by coating a coating composition including organic polymer linker material on a substrate; forming a seed colloid catalytic layer by coating a gold colloid dispersion on the organic polymer linker material layer; drying or heat-treating the substrate on which the seed colloid catalytic layer is formed; and obtaining a gold thin layer by coating a coating composition that includes a gold salt-containing aqueous solution and a reducing agent-containing solution.

    Abstract: A composition for a transparent conductive layer, a transparent conductive layer formed of the composition, and a method for forming the transparent conductive layer. The composition comprises a metal (M.sub.1) particle, a binding agent and a solvent, wherein the metal (M.sub.1) particle has an average particle diameter of 10.about.30 nm and is at least one selected from the group consisting of gold (Au), silver (Ag), platinum (Pt), copper (Cu), nickel (Ni), lead (Pb), cobalt (Co), rhodium (Rh), ruthenium (Ru), palladium (Pd) and tin (Sn), and wherein the binding agent is at least one compound selected from the group consisting of polypyrrole, polyvinylpyrrolidone, polyvinylalcohol and silicon alkoxide oligomer. Therefore, the transparent conductive layer which is excellent in conductivity and transmittance can be formed by a low-temperature sintering process.

    Abstract: A process for manufacturing a color picture tube capable of minimizing the thermal deformation of the shadow mask is disclosed. A getter is filled with a Ba material, a high or low vaporizing material having a different vaporizing temperature compared with that of the Ba material, and the getter is installed within the color picture tube. The getter is heated by a microwave heating device, so that the Ba material is vaporized so that the vacuum level of the color picture tube is raised. The high or low vaporizing material is vaporized and coated onto an aluminum film of a panel or on the surface of the shadow mask. This vaporizing material layer coated on the aluminum film or on the surface of the shadow mask absorbs the heat generated by the shadow mask, so that the thermal expansion and the thermal deformation of the shadow mask is inhibited, thereby improving the colorimetric purity of the phosphor screen and extending the life expectancy of the color picture tube.
